Commercial Slab Installation in Bellingham, WA
Commercial slab installation services involve preparing and pouring concrete slabs that serve as foundational surfaces for various types of structures, including parking lots, loading docks, storage areas, and building foundations. These projects typically require careful site assessment, precise leveling, and durable concrete work to ensure long-lasting, stable surfaces capable of supporting heavy equipment or high foot traffic. Property owners often want to understand the scope of the project, including site preparation, material quality, and the expected lifespan of the slab, to make informed decisions about their construction or renovation plans.
Before requesting commercial slab installation, property owners should consider factors such as the intended use of the area, load requirements, and environmental conditions that could affect the concrete’s performance. It’s also helpful to clarify the timeline for project completion and any specific design preferences or specifications. Proper planning and communication can help ensure the finished slab meets the needs of the property and provides a reliable foundation for years to come.

Common Commercial Slab Installation Jobs
Commercial slab installation involves laying durable concrete foundations for various business and industrial buildings.
Parking lot slabs create level, stable surfaces for vehicle access and parking areas.
Sidewalk and walkway slabs provide safe, even walkways around commercial properties.
Loading dock slabs support heavy equipment and facilitate efficient freight handling.
Foundation slabs serve as the base for new commercial structures or building extensions.
Industrial floor slabs are designed to withstand heavy traffic and equipment in warehouse settings.
Commercial Slab Installation Questions
What types of projects require a commercial slab installation? Commercial slab installations are often used for building foundations, parking lots, loading docks, and outdoor workspaces on commercial properties.
What materials are commonly used for commercial slabs? Concrete is the most common material, chosen for its durability and strength suitable for high-traffic and heavy loads.
What should property owners consider before installing a commercial slab? Proper site preparation, soil stability, and drainage are important factors to ensure a long-lasting and functional slab.
How does the size of the slab impact installation requirements? Larger slabs may require additional reinforcement and specific planning to ensure stability and even curing across the entire surface.
